A GERMAN SILVER-GILT DESSERT SERVICE
MARK OF PHILIPP HEINRICH JAGER, AUGSBURG, 1724-1728
The handles decorated with engraved strapwork and applied classical busts, comprising:
Twenty-two dessert spoons
Twenty-two dessert forks
Twenty-two dessert knives
In a fitted wood case
90 oz. 8 dwt. (2,811 gr.) weighable silver
